WebNeurology is a non competitive specialty, going unfilled in the match, often ending up taking AMG/IMG. Historically, people tend to avoid neurology because diseases are not well understood, and there were little to offer in terms of treatment. There have been great strides, which are attracting more strong US candidates. Sponsored by Orthojoe™
